Hi gang. Got a problem with rining pwdump in Windows 7 (maybe a bad idea to begin with because I'm not sure pwdump is compatible with W7 please make note if you know). As I understood one needs to run the program as admin so I run the cmd as admin. Tryed to run pwdump which told me that I have to run it as user Administrator. Now I am not sure about the next step: when I try the runas /user:Administrator pwdump it tells me that user does not exist or bad password(which it isn't since I am the admin user) and when I try with runas /user:<my_username> pwdump it comes out empty. So would like to know if I am doing something wrong or did I get wrong pwdump and should perhapes try with pwdump2 3 6 or 7 or something else because others are not compatible with W7?

There is a difference between running a program as Administrator and the user Administrator in Windows. The Administrator account built in to Windows has to be enabled first before its use. Have a look at "Enable the administrator account in windows 7".
